The following checklist outlines design requirements per the Stormwater Best Management Practices manual (N C
Department of Environment, Health and Natural Resources, November 1995) and Administrative Code Section 15
A NCAC 2H 1008
Initial in the space provided to indicate the following design requirements have been met and supporting
documentation is attached If the applicant has designated an agent in the Stormwater Management Permit
Application Form, the agent may initial below Attach justification if a requirement has not been met
Applicants Initials
a
System is located 50 feet from class SA waters and 30 feet from other surface waters
b
System is located at least 100 feet from water supply wells
i c
Bottom of system is at least 2 feet above the seasonal high water table
d
Bottom of the system is 3 feet above any bedrock or impervious soil horizon
NA e
Off-line system, runoff is excess of the design volume bypasses the system (bypass detail
provided)
f
System is designed to draw down the design storage volume to the proposed bottom
elevation under seasonal high water conditions within five days based upon infiltration
through the bottom only (a hydrogeologic evaluation may be required)
Al g
Soils have a minimum hydraulic conductivity of 0 52 inches per hour
Alh
System is not sites on or in fill material or DWQ approval has been obtained
Al i
Plans ensure that the installed system will meet design specifications (constructed or
restored) upon initial operation once the project is complete and the entire drainage area is
stabilized
System is sized to take into account the runoff at the ultimate built -out potential from all
surfaces draining to the system, including any off -site drainage
k System is located in a recorded drainage easement for the purposes of operation and
maintenance and has recorded access easements to the nearest public right-of-way
1 System captures and infiltrates the runoff from the first 1 0 inch of rainfall (1 5 inch event
for areas draining to SA waters)
m Drainage area for the device is less than 5 acres
�- n A pretreatment device ( filter strip, grassed swale, sediment trap, etc ) is provided
o Trench bottom is covered with a layer of clean sand to an average depth of 4 inches
p Sides of infiltration trench are lined with geotextile fabric
q Rock used is free of fines (washed stone) and has large void ratio
r Side to bottom ratio is less than 4 1
